Season Analysis

Denton Mateychuk's rookie NHL campaign with the Columbus Blue Jackets in 2024-25 showcased the promising development of the 12th overall pick from the 2022 NHL Draft. After dominating the WHL and capturing both the Bill Hunter Memorial Trophy as top defenseman and playoff MVP honors, Mateychuk made a successful transition to the professional ranks.

The 20-year-old defenseman appeared in 45 games for the Blue Jackets, recording 4 goals and 9 assists for 13 points while maintaining a +4 rating. His average ice time of 18:03 per game demonstrates head coach Dean Evason's growing trust in the young blueliner, particularly after his December 23rd NHL debut. Mateychuk's advanced metrics paint an intriguing picture of his defensive development. His Impact Per 60 metrics show a total impact of 4.58, with a notably stronger defensive component (3.33 defensive impact per 60) compared to his offensive numbers (1.95 offensive impact per 60). This suggests he's adapting well to the defensive responsibilities of the NHL game while maintaining his offensive instincts.

His high-danger Corsi metrics (46.7% HDCF%) indicate room for improvement in shot suppression, though he's performing relatively close to team averages, allowing 0.9 fewer high-danger chances per 60 minutes than the team baseline. This is particularly impressive for a rookie defenseman thrust into significant minutes. Before his NHL promotion, Mateychuk excelled with the Cleveland Monsters, posting 25 points (9 goals, 16 assists) in 27 AHL games, earning an AHL All-Star selection and Rookie of the Month honors in November 2024. His smooth transition between levels speaks to his adaptability and hockey IQ.

Opponent impact metrics reveal Mateychuk performed particularly well against divisional rivals, with two of his top 3 highest impact ratings coming against Washington (1.947 avg impact per game) and Pittsburgh (1.84 avg impact per game). This success against familiar opponents suggests he's quickly learning to adapt to NHL competition levels.

Key Takeaway: Mateychuk's rookie season demonstrates he's developing into a reliable two-way defenseman who can contribute at both ends of the ice. His strong defensive metrics combined with offensive upside position him as a potential cornerstone of the Blue Jackets' blueline moving forward. Under Dean Evason's system, his role appears likely to expand as he continues to gain NHL experience.
